The Bermadon automatically admits a preset amount of water and then shuts off the supply line.
The amount required is set with the knob on the Bermadon. The internal mechanism driven by the water-volume flow counts backwards to the supply shut-off point. This prevents excess water from passing through, thus avoiding any waste. Any quantity can be set within the scale range. The Bermadon operates without electricity and/or timer, and delivers exactly the amount that is needed!
Pressure variations and/or flow-rate differences do not influence this process.
In the case of soiled water, a prefilter is to be installed.
Product features:
- Simple design without needing any provisions for electricity.
- Reliable and accurate operation.
- The amount of water being delivered is independent of pressure variations.
- Easy to install in any position desired.
- Saves water and protects against excess water by automatic cut-off.
Applications:
- Watering lawns
- For small irrigation systems
- Filling water storage tanks
- Providing cattle with drinking water
